here's some sketches that may help
note use of boards at every layer...not really necessary, probably could get by with just one at middle layer, but since I like to tort every layer, feel better safe than sorry buildint this high and with the carved shape.
note areas w/ hatching that you have to cut away (save for cake balls)
cover in fondant (my first pref.) or BC.
If doing fondant, I do base first, then add bottom half of dome, cover it, then add top minus dome top and cover it, then top off w/ white dome.
re: white top....bake the basic shape in either a soccer ball pan or some type of pyrex bowl or other dome shaped pan. trim down for the low dome.
detailing of lines can be done in many ways: painted on, done w/ frosting, etc. and if fondant even impressed (toothpick?) into the fondant.
if this seems too big, scale down to a 9x9 square base and use 8" rounds.
